Each phase can be documented and reviewed: the objective is to make the logic that connects the data collected to operational decisions transparent.
The system acquires market data, trading volumes and volatility indicators from multiple sources, continuously updating them to build a coherent analytical base.
The investor sets his own risk tolerance parameters through a structured questionnaire; these values become operational constraints for the model, not simple general indications.
The model combines the collected data with risk constraints to propose a consistent allocation, periodically recalculated based on observed market conditions.
The model operates within user-defined safeguards and does not exceed them for the sake of potential additional yield. Dynamic rebalancing occurs when actual exposure moves away from the set profile, not based on short-term forecasts.
Three examples of how the same analytical engine adapts to different objectives and tolerances.
It favors stability: the model favors assets with lower volatility and maintains limited exposure thresholds, with more frequent rebalancing in the event of marked fluctuations.
Accept moderate volatility in exchange for broader growth potential; the model distributes exposure between consolidated assets and more dynamic positions.
Tolerates larger swings in the face of higher growth targets; the safeguard parameters remain active, but with more permissive thresholds defined by the user himself.
